Foreign.

The Brooklyn tabernacle in New York has been destroyed by fire. The fire took place at the conelu* aion of Dr Talmage's Sunday morn» ing services. The Holy Land relics were burned. The Eegent Hotel caught and was also destroyed. The fire originated in connection with the Electrio motor working the organ in the tabernacle. The darnaga is estimated at ojer a million dollars Pr Talmage observed the flre after the service had been concluded, and cautioned the congregation against a panic. Ib was owing to this preoautloq that no casualties ooourred,
